The town of Carpinteria, founded in 1863, is noted for its friendliness, small town charm and the agricultural production of avocados, lemons, and flowers. This community is dedicated to preserving the coast at it recently purchased the coastal bluffs just southeast of town which will be kept as they are with a hiking and biking trail along the coast. The downtown area is within an easy walking distance from the beach and offers a variety of antique, clothing, and specialty shops. Carpinteria is fast becoming a mecca for the fine arts representing music, dance, paint, sculpture, and theater. Don't miss Carpinteria's latest addition, the Art Center, with revisions planned thanks to the generous donations of our citizens. Carpinteria's local theater has revised its name to reclaim the original name, The Alcazar. They host concerts, movies, original plays, fundraisers, and talent shows. More recently, restaurants have found a home here, representing cuisine from all corners of the earth. They bring foodies and critics to sample their fine dining. World famous beer and wine have also located to Carpinteria via breweries like Island Brewing Company, wineries, pubs and tasting rooms. Points of interest include the historical museum, the world's largest Torrey Pine tree, the Carpinteria Tar Pits where the Chumash built their canoes and the famous 'cook your own steak' Palms restaurant. World famous surfing at Rincon Point is located only 5 minutes away by car. 5 minutes in the opposite direction on a beautiful sunny afternoon will have you enjoying your refreshments while watching world-class polo ponies at Santa Barbara Polo Club which is open to the public.
